Srikanth

Actor Srikanth who is actually on full swing with Shankar's venture Nanban, appears to have gone in for a complete makeover having lost a lot of weight off late.The young hero is on rigid diet and hitting gym regularly to sport a young college student look.








Talking from the film's sets in Dehradhun, Srikanth says, "Director Shankar has given me a golden opportunity on a platter and I want to make full use of it. He wanted me to lose a lot of weight for the college student role which I am playing in Nanban. Shankar sir was clear that I should look very young. But he stressed that I shouldn't look tired on screen due to the long workout sessions. When I finally saw the outcome in pictures, I was very happy. This is exactly how I look on my driving license! For my role as a wildlife photographer, I will sport a different look."

Srikanth celebrated his birthday recently on the sets of Nanban. "Sentimentally, I think shooting on my birthday brings me luck. It was sweet of Shankar and the team to bring in a birthday cake for me. However, I was a little low because I was away from my family and my son, who also celebrated his birthday on the same day!"

He continues, "Vijay and Jiiva are such wonderful co-stars. I can't stop gushing about Shankar's sense of humour. He's got a serious face but manages to makes us laugh so much! We're currently gearing up to shoot the song, All is well…. Though the catch-phrase is the same, Harris sir has come out with a different tune. Shobi master is choreographing the number and Manoj is handling the camera. This song will have Shankar's touch!"

"The film will certainly give me a new lease of life in Kollywood.", he concludes.
